Big Tex Backyard Ultra Race Description

LAST RUNNER STANDING - 2024 BIG DOG'S BRONZE TICKET

 

NOVEMBER 1st, 2024

 

 

 

Updated Venue: We are excited to announce that Big Tex 2024 is moving closer to Houston and will be hosted at Stephen F. Austin State Park in San Felipe allowing a large grass area for personal aid setup around our group dining hall screen shelter as well as campsites and full hookup RV sites. We will have 60 overnight spots available at the group dining hall area (stay tuned to secure your spot). The SFA State Park has a network of wide well-maintained trails, primarily crushed gravel, with minimal elevation change.

 

 

 

Back for year two, The Big Tex Backyard is a "last runner standing" format event with a 4.17 mile "yard" starting every hour, on the hour, until there is only one remaining. Standard backyard format rules will apply (see below details). 2024 is a Bronze Ticket race to Laz's Big Dog's Backyard road to the 2025 Silver Ticket Races to the 2026 National Championships to the 2027 Backyard World Championships.

 

 

 

All participants will receive a Big Tex hoodie, a special customized participant giveaway, and fully stocked aid station support. Runners completing 24 yards will receive a 100mi buckle. The winner will win a dollar for every mile they run and the seconder will win a dollar for every yard they finish!**

 

 

 

Backyard Format Rules

 

 

 

The Backyard format is simple: 100 miles divided into 24 hours give you 4.167 miles for a "yard" (lap). Every hour, on the hour, a new yard will start and you must finish within the hour and be back in the starting corral for the next one to stay in the run. Complete as many as you can, the last runner standing wins.

 

 

 

Runners and crew will be able to set up a personal area with chairs, tents, etc. around the start/finish course-line area for personal aid, gear, and rest between yards (not during).

 

 

 

We will give a 3-minute, 2-minute, and 1-minute warning to be inside the starting corral for the next yard.​

 

 

 

All runners are required to be in the starting corral before the top of the hour.

 

 

 

Failure to line up in the starting corral will result in the disqualification of the runner. Participants must start a new yard at the sound, and continue out on the course (not back to their tent, aid, etc.).

 

 

 

Once you are on the course, you are not allowed any aid from your crew or any other individual. No non-competitors on the course (including eliminated runners). Except for restrooms, competitors may not leave the course until each loop is completed. Runners are responsible for their own aid on the course (carried with them from the start). You must be on and stay on the course unless you need to use the bathroom.

 

 

 

No artificial aids (including trekking poles) are allowed. Once you complete the yard, and assuming you have finished within the hour, you may use the bathroom, eat, drink, sleep, ponder the next yard, aid station, etc., but you MUST be back in the start corral at the beginning of the hour to continue into the next hour’s yard. Runners will continue until ONE runner completes a FINAL lap. (i.e. If there are two runners left and one does not complete the loop, then the one that completed the loop will be declared the winner). No pacers whatsoever. A single runner can not continue solo beyond the final yard.

 

 

 

You must check out with the race director once you can not complete a yard or decide not to begin the next yard.

 

 

 

**Overall Cash Prize Rules: Overall winner per backyard rules must complete one more yard than everyone else (otherwise no winner), no seconder payout if more than one seconder.

 

 

 

Silver Ticket: Update from Laz on the road to Big's: TROT has applied for a 2025 Silver Ticket and with the application will receive a Bronze Ticket for 2024 (this year). "Bronze ticket winners earn a spot in a silver ticket race, and silver ticket winners earn a place on the national team to compete on the third Saturday of October 2026. The top 50 winners of the national championships earn a place at Big's world individual championships on the third Saturday of October 2027."

 

 

 

Daylight Savings:

 

Sunday, November 3, 2024, 2:00:00 am clocks are turned backward 1 hour to Sunday, November 3, 2024, 1:00:00 am local standard time. You will not lose your 1 AM Yard, we'll just be starting two different yards at 1 AM on Sunday, back-to-back. No different, every hour on the hour.

 

Sunrise and sunset will be about 1 hour earlier on Nov 3, 2024 than the day before. There will be more light in the morning and less light in the evening.
